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$1,266 per month in Banja Luka vs $1,232 in Phuket, rent included.

A couple spends around $1,923 per month in Banja Luka vs $2,054 in Phuket, rent included.

A family of three spends $2,579 per month in Banja Luka vs $2,876 in Phuket, rent included.

Banja Luka costs about 3% more than Phuket, driven mainly by Eating Out.

Both Banja Luka and Phuket are more affordable than the global median – Banja Luka 7% lower, Phuket 10%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$480 in Banja Luka versus $738 in Phuket.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 83% higher in Banja Luka,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$51.0 in Banja Luka versus $32.00 in Phuket. Groceries tell a different story – $250 in Banja Luka vs $274 in Phuket – so Banja Luka wins on supermarket bills even if dining out costs more.
